Transaction e8626390690108c0b6a0845671ef0d64ded930401d60926ee28e15857d297170

1 Input
2 Outputs
  • e8626390690108c0b6a0845671ef0d64ded930401d60926ee28e15857d297170:0
  • value  3772754475
    address  2NAqzkgGhxVhJUh7SM1efcQJdD8F3T46BhL
  • e8626390690108c0b6a0845671ef0d64ded930401d60926ee28e15857d297170:1
  • value  3141015
    address  2Mvi9unahYDueUpMx3Pkf2tx9q1AkFDQSn5